Abstract

Brassica juncea L. seedlings were screened for the presence of compounds of medicinal importance under imidacloprid (IMI) stress in binary combination wit h 24-epibrassinolide (24-EBL). The compounds were i dentified using gas chromatography-mass spectroscopy (GC-MS). The compounds identified were 4,5-epithiovaleronit rile, 2- naphthoic acid-methyl ester, L-(+)-ascorbic acid 2, 6-dihexadecanoate, phytol, 9,12-octadecadienoic aci d (Z,Z), 9- octadecenoic acid, alpha-tocopherol, ergosta-5,22-d ien-3-beta-ol, campesterol and gamma-sitosterol. Mu ltiple linear regression (MLR) analysis of data revealed t hat increase in IMI concentrations results into dec line in the concentrations of these compounds, whereas seed pre -soaking with 24-EBL significantly decreased the IM I toxicity and enhanced the phytochemical concentrations.
